Android Central have come across a screenshot of 2 new devices with SKU’s on Vodafone Germany’s stock system.
The devices clearly state that the Desire HD will be the so called HTC Ace device which is like the HTC Incredible which is already on sale in the USA but with a few tweeks for GSM use.
Also the HTC Vision (the leaked phone with slide out keyboard) looks to be called the HTC Desire Z.
Strange name for the Vision and these are NOT confirmed so could change still
